The concept stretches across many traditions, where animals serve as spiritual protectors or reflections of personal strength. Because the word "totem" relates to specific cultures, many people choose a design that feels personal and respectful rather than copying sacred imagery.

Originating from centuries-old cultural practices, tribal designs carry symbolic weight through their patterns and placement. Modern tribal tattoos adapt these traditional motifs into contemporary compositions that honor the style's heritage.

Calf tattoos benefit from a muscular canvas that gives designs depth and presence. The flat rear surface works well for portraits and detailed work, while wrapping designs follow the leg's natural shape.
